| Thiago Alves isn't moving to MW/ would like to fight Dan Hardy. Thiago Alves up for fighting Dan Hardy in England | UFC News | ESPN.co.uk Quote:
Thiago Alves witnessed firsthand as Dan Hardy got knocked out by Carlos Condit at UFC 120, but he admits he would love to fight the Briton in the future.
Hardy suffered the first KO of his MMA career in a first-round loss to Condit on Saturday, making it two defeats on the spin following his failed title shot against Georges St-Pierre. The Outlaw now faces a 30-day medical suspension, after which he will set about erasing the pain of his latest loss as soon as possible.
The UFC is known to have a liking for putting two fighters who are coming off defeats both in the same Octagon, which makes a Hardy v Alves collision a possibility after the Brazilian's loss to Jon Fitch. And Alves admits he would happily fight Hardy in England if that was what the UFC had in mind.
"I don't pick my fights, but if Joe Silva says we should match up, I think it'd be a great fight for me. I think he's a great fighter, so let's do it," Alves told ESPN. "I really don't have a specific place to fight in. Once I step in the Octagon, that's home for me. So if it happens to be here [in England], good. If it's in American, that's fine. Brazil? I'm ready for that too."
Those words would appear to confirm that Alves is staying in the welterweight division, despite failing to cut weight for his Fitch encounter. UFC president Dana White stated clearly that he believes The Pitbull belongs at middleweight, but Alves is adamant he will stay at 170lbs.
